In the words of Alama Iqbal.....................

Qatl e Husain (AS) asl me marg e Yazid he,
Islam zinda hota he her Karbala ke bad."

"Slaughter of Husain (AS) is in fact the death of Yazid,
Islam is revitalized after each event like that of Karbala."
------------------------------------
gharib o sada o rangeen he dastan e haram,
nehayat is ki Hussain (AS), ibtida he Ismael (AS)"

Story of the family (haram) is unfortunate, simple and colorfull.
It began with Ismael (AS) and ended with Husain (AS)"

Here Allama Iqbal is refereeing to the following verse of Quran predicting Zibhin-Adheem, the Great Sacrifice of Karbala:

And We ransomed him with a great sacrifice. Al-Quran 37.107

Where Allah accepted the sacrifice of Ibrahim (AS) and saved his son Ismail (AS) IN EXCHANGE FOR a Great Sacrifice (Zibhin-Adheem), the slaughter of Imam Husain (AS) who was from his generation.

Na Sateeza gah-e-jahan nayi, na hareef-e-panja fagan naye..
wohi fitrat-e-Asadullahi wohe Marhabi wohi Antari

Neither are the battle grounds of the world new, nor are the opponents who are fighting. Same are the ways of (those who follow) Allahs Lion (Imam Ali(AS), and same are the ways of (those who follow) Marhab and Antar (with whom he fought).
---------------------------------------
Islam kay Daman main bus is do hi to chezain hain
Ik zarbe yadullahi ik sajda-e-shabbiri

There are only and only two things which Islam have (or due to which Islam stands). One is the striking of the Hand of Allah (Imam Ali's[as] sword) and other is the prostration of Shabbir (Imam Hussain[as])

First the quote of Imam Al Ghazali Rahima Hu Allah (d.1111 C.E) the Imam of Islam who is still being considered by the vast majority of Muslim and orientalist scholars as the greatest personality of Islam after the Prophet Muhammad Salalla Hu Alihi Wasalam. Here is his quote about Yazid Ibn Muawiyaa to whom all of our brothers consciously or unconsciously abuse day in and day out whilst remembering the sad and traumatic events of Karbala that took place on Muharram 10, 61 Hijri year;

He was a Muslim with a correct Aqeedah (Dogma / creed) and a complete Muslim and it is not permissible in the Shareeah to curse and abuse him.

Source: see Ahyaa al-Uloom (3/108), Wafyaat al-Ayaan (1/328), Miratul-Janaan (3/176), al-Bidaayah Wan-Nihaayah (12/173), Hayaat al-Haiwaan (2/176), Sawaaiq al-Meharqah (pg.222), Dhuu al-Maalee (pg.49), Sharh Fiqhul-Akbar (pg.87), Nibraas (pg.551), Shadhraat adh-Dhahab Fee Akhbaar Minal Madhab (1/69), Tafseer Rooh al-Maanee (13/73), Fataawa Azeezee (1/100), Fataawa Abdul-Hayy (1/60), Aqaaid al-Islaam (pg.223).

Now the second quote is from one more Mujadid and Shaikh (The honorary title which has been bestowed to him among the vast majority of Muslim scholars of his contemporary and successive ages) of Islam the great Imam Ibn Taymiyyah (d. 1328 C.E) the founder of Salafi movement and the man who is widely attributed for the formalization of Analogical Reasoning as acknowledged by the western and Muslim scholars alike. The most widely read Tafsir (Exegesis of Holy Quran) of our age is The Tafsir Ibn Kathir and here is Hafiz Ibn Kathirs (Who is a renowned scholar in his own right) views about the great Imam who happened to be his teacher as well;

He (Imam Ibn Taymiyyah) was knowledgeable in fiqh. And it was said that he was more knowledgeable of fiqh of the madh'habs than the followers of those very same madh'habs, (both) in his time and other than his time. He was a scholar of the fundamental issues, the subsidiary issues, of grammar, language, and other textual and intellectual sciences. And no scholar of a science would speak to him except that he thought the science was of speciality of Ibn Taymiyyah. As for Hadith, then he was the carrier of its flag, a Hafidh, able to distinguish the weak from the strong and fully acquainted with the narrators

Source: Mountains of Knowledge, pg. 220, quoting Al-Bidaayah wan-Nihaayah'(14/118-119)

Anyhow these are the words of Imam Ibn Taymiyyah related to Yazid Ibn Muawiya on the subject of cursing him due to his alleged role in the massacre of Karbala;

"And the people who curse Yazeed and other such people like him then it is UPON them to bring evidence, Firstly: that he (Yazeed) was an open sinner and an oppressor and therefore prove he really was an open sinner and an oppressor. As allowing them to be cursed also need to be proven that he continued this open sinning and oppression to the end up until his death. Secondly: Then after this they must prove that it is permissible to curse specific people like Yazeed."

Source: Ibn Kathirs famous work of Al Bidayya Wan Nihayaa quoting his master Imam Ibn Taymiyyah Rahima Hu Allah.
